Northern Trust is seeking a seasoned Principal Cyber Security Engineer to lead the firms Software as a Service (SaaS) security program with a primary focus on implementing and operationalizing Obsidian Security. This role will be instrumental in shaping the security posture of Northern Trusts SaaS ecosystem driving threat detection posture management and compliance across critical business applications.

Reporting to the Global Head of Attack Surface Management you will play a vital role within the firms Information Security program. This leader will be responsible for operating all of the technology in the remit of Attack Surface Management including Vulnerability Management Secure Configuration Application Security and External Attack Surface management. This position will lead a global team and work with internal service delivery units along with managed service providers to ensure that the NT is able to meets the needs of our partners clients and regulators in this area.

Job Responsibilities:

SaaS Security Program Leadership:

  • Own and evolve Northern Trusts strategic SaaS security roadmap aligning with enterprise risk appetite and regulatory expectations
  • Lead the deployment configuration and tuning of Obsidian Security across prioritized SaaS platforms
  • Define and enforce baseline security implementation guidelines for SaaS applications including privileged access identity governance data protection and logging/monitoring

Obsidian Security Implementation:

  • Stand up and manage Obsidian Security as Northern Trusts Software as a Service Posture Management (SSPM) solution
  • Integrate Obsidian with ServiceNow and other platforms ensuring secure API connectivity and centralized authentication
  • Monitor and triage threat detection alerts reduce false positives and drive operational efficiency through governed engagement models

Technical Oversight & Governance:

  • Collaborate with Enterprise Architecture Cloud Center of Excellence and IAM teams to ensure consistent security patterns and governance
  • Develop and maintain control procedures and documentation in alignment with CTRM policies and standards
  • Support regulatory mapping and enablement of frameworks such as CIS benchmarks within Obsidian
  • Oversee effective KPIs / monitoring to ensure Attack Surface Management technologies are operating within defined standards and controls

Vendor Management:

  • Partners with key technology vendors (Software and Managed Services providers) to ensure NT is getting optimal value for spend.

Executive Briefing:

  • Brief senior leadership business units and regulators on relevant threats process improvements and readiness for change.

Qualifications:

  • 8 years of experience in cybersecurity engineering with a focus on SaaS or cloud security.
  • Proven experience implementing SSPM or CSPM tools; direct experience with Obsidian Security strongly preferred
  • Deep understanding of security configuration identity federation API security and SaaS-to-SaaS data movement
  • Strong communication and stakeholder management skills.
  • Relevant certifications (e.g. CISSP CCSP AWS/Azure Security Engineer) are a plus
